After Jian He was awarded $447,450 in damages for assault after a civil trial against Hai Huang, He’s lawyer discovered Huang’s house had been transferred to his son for $1.

A judge has ruled that the transfer of a Nanaimo house to a family member for $1 by a man who owed more than $400,000 in damages constituted a “fraudulent conveyance.”Jian He was awarded $447,450 in damages after a civil trial against Hai Huang for an August 2013 assault.

Although the 2016 house transfer stands, Jian He is allowed to register a judgment against the property and act on it, Baird said.The court received medical records indicating Jian He had a perforated eardrum that required surgery after the assault, and that he suffered from depression and post-traumatic stress disorder that his doctor attributed to the incident.

No money has been paid towards the award. Huang told the court he has not worked since 2014, when he was in his mid-50s, and said he has no assets, the decision said. They also said that it is Chinese custom for children to continue living with their parents after marriage and to take on responsibility for family costs, look after their parents in their old age and eventually receive the parents’ property in compensation.

After weighing their evidence, he said, “I have decided that it falls well short of rebutting the presumption that the transfer was fraudulent.” The house transfer had deprived Jian He from being able to register the damages judgment against the property’s title.
